Local amateur boat builders amass cardboard and duct tape

Over 2,500 people are expected to attend this year’s 3rd Annual Clermont Cardboard Classic coming early in August.

The event will be two days of boatbuilding and racing for trophies and medals based on creativity and engineering. Registration will be divided into the Tadpole Elementary, Guppy Middle School, Dolphin and Pods family, young adults and high school division, and the Whale adult category. Moby Dick boats of four or more adults will cost $80.

The event will kick off on the Friday evening in downtown Clermont. Last-minute registration, check-in, and beginning of onsite boat building starts at 6:00 pm. Entrants can also bring boats they built at home. The public will vote on their favorite boats from 6:00 pm until 9:00 pm.

Saturday’s schedule has race day beginning with more boat building from 9:00 am until 11:00 am. From 10:00 am to 11:00 am, boaters check in. That will be followed with the races starting at noon. Awards will be presented at 7:30 pm, and the event will close with Norse Funeral at 8:15 pm.

The Friday night festivities will be at Waterfront Park, 330 3rd Street, August 7. The races will be Saturday, August 8 at Victory Point, 1050 Victory Way.
